16-Year-Old Girl Disappeared Without a Trace – Father Laughed When Police Made a Horrible Discovery in the Backyard

A chilling case from 1987 is revisited as police discover the remains of 16-year-old Heather West in her parents' backyard, highlighting the indifference of her parents to her disappearance and linking it to a new Netflix documentary about the notorious couple Fred and Rose West.

The article discusses the tragic story of 16-year-old Heather West, who vanished in 1987 under mysterious circumstances, and how her parents, Fred and Rose West, approached her disappearance with disturbing indifference. Initially, the couple downplayed their daughter’s absence, using her as a joke in a conversation about misbehaving children. This shocking revelation gives insight into the atmosphere of neglect and horror in the West household, which was initially ignored by those around them.

Years later, Heather's siblings divulged that she was buried in the backyard, ultimately leading police to excavate the Wests’ home in Gloucester. The discovery marks a grim milestone in a case that remained stagnant for many years, emphasizing the challenges authorities faced in unearthing the truth about the West family’s actions. Former police officers and relatives of the victims provide their perspectives, recounting the long journey to finding justice in such a harrowing case.

The broader implications of this story also connect to a new Netflix documentary titled 'Fred and Rose West: The British Horror Story', which sheds light on the heinous crimes committed by the Wests and their eventual arrest in 1994. This documentary aims to give a voice to the victims and their families, reminding society of the tragic tales lost in the shadows of criminal history. It serves both as a documentary about the serial killer couple and a reflection on the systemic failures that allowed such atrocities to occur.
